The index of refraction of silicate flint glass for red light is 1.620 and for violet light is 1.660. A beam of white light in this glass strikes the glass-air interface at a 21.10 degree angle of incidence and refracts out into air. Find the angular separation between the red and violet components of the spectrum that emerges from the glass?
